How to Keep Hair Looking Shiny and Healthy

In these summer months it is essential that you look after your hair, being in the sun can cause your hair to dry out which means split ends. Some people are under the illusion that the more hair is washed the healthier it will be, this is not the case.

Products

The key to healthy hair is to use the correct products for your hair type, for example if you have coloured hair then using shampoo and condition specifically for it then you will avoid your hair colour fading and looking lifeless. A great way of making sure that your hair stays full of body and shine is to use natural products that aren't clogged with harsh petrochemicals, natural products tend to be gentler on the hair and with a boom in interest for them they are now widely available on the high street.

It is also best to use a shampoo and a conditioner to wash your hair, the reason hair loses its shine is because it is dry, using a conditioner will combat this and give you gorgeous hair. It is also best to wash your hair every other day, as using various products on it day in and day out can also dry it out.

Heat Styling.

This can be so damaging to hair, causing split ends and dullness if not done in the correct manner. When blow drying, straightening or curling hair the proper precautions should be used. There are various products out there that will protect your hair from the heat, they stop your hair drying out and keep it moisturised so by the end of the styling process you will help beautifully styled, shiny hair.

Tips and Tricks

If you rinse your hair with cold water it will enhance its shine, the reason for this is that the cold water doesn't dry the hair instead it smooths the cuticles making it look softer and more full of shine.

Once your hair is dry brush through it a couple of times with a brush or comb, this will distribute the natural oils from your scalp across your hair giving it a fabulous, all natural shine. Try and use a brush that is full of natural bristles this will ensure that you don't just brush out all the essential oils.

When you've finished blow-drying or straightening your hair give your locks a blast of cold air to help smooth those cuticles once again. This gives a similar effect to rinsing your hair with cold water and also helps to protect against heat damage.
